Lately i have been wondering what music BT has been playing in his laptop or dj sets. mainly how would you describe his sound. just curious as i have listen to his great production, but not LIVE performance.

Pretty much everything i believe!

Hi set at TT was a lot of his old stuff, with some interesting remixes and a few other productions thrown in. I saw hm in Miami as he closed out Ultra Fest this year and he played lotsa old-skoool-nu-skool breaks (which admittedly wasn't all i had hoped it would be). The great thing about Mr Transeau is that he thrives on the big room stuff imo – i'm sure he'll bring the good stuff to GK next week

LOL i had just put my foot on the step to walk up onto stage to take some photos from behind him when the power went out... for a split second i thought i'd kicked out a cord and it was my fault. I nearly died!

That was some beautiful improvization while his laptop rebooted though.

"I'm playing some shit in b-flat 'cos i'm about to play Godspeed!"

*crowd goes mental*
